About the Author

Herman Agoyo is a distinguished author and cultural historian whose work illuminates the rich tapestry of Native American history and resistance. Born and raised in the Southwest, Agoyo draws from his deep-rooted Pueblo heritage to craft narratives that honor indigenous voices often overlooked in mainstream discourse. His writing bridges the past and present, exploring themes of leadership, rebellion, and cultural preservation with a profound sense of authenticity and empathy. As a storyteller committed to truth-telling, Agoyo has dedicated his career to educating readers about the pivotal events that shaped early American history, ensuring that stories of resilience endure for future generations. Through his meticulous research and evocative prose, he invites audiences to reconsider the foundations of the nation through an indigenous lens.
